引言
随着人工智能技术的飞速发展,大模型在各个领域中的应用日益广泛。大模型推理作为AI技术的重要环节,其高效能和背后的秘密引发了广泛关注。本文将深入探讨大模型推理的原理、关键技术、挑战以及未来发展趋势。
大模型推理概述
什么是大模型推理?
大模型推理指的是在给定输入数据的情况下,利用大模型(如深度学习模型)进行计算并得到输出结果的过程。大模型推理是AI技术在实际应用中的关键环节,其性能直接影响着AI系统的效果。
大模型推理的特点
- 高精度:大模型具有更强的特征提取和表示能力,能够更准确地处理复杂问题。
- 泛化能力强:大模型能够处理多种类型的输入数据,具有较强的泛化能力。
- 实时性:随着硬件和算法的优化,大模型推理的实时性能不断提升。
大模型推理关键技术
1. 模型压缩与加速
为了降低大模型推理的复杂度和计算量,模型压缩与加速技术应运而生。主要包括以下几种方法:
- 模型剪枝:通过移除模型中不必要的神经元,降低模型复杂度。
- 量化:将模型中的浮点数参数转换为低精度数值,减少存储和计算需求。
- 知识蒸馏:将大模型的知识迁移到小模型中,提高小模型的性能。
2. 硬件加速
随着人工智能芯片的快速发展,硬件加速技术在提升大模型推理性能方面发挥着重要作用。主要硬件加速方案包括:
- GPU加速:利用GPU强大的并行计算能力,加速大模型推理。
- FPGA加速:针对特定场景,使用FPGA进行定制化加速。
- ASIC加速:针对特定应用,设计专用ASIC芯片进行加速。
3. 软件优化
软件优化包括以下几个方面:
- 并行计算:利用多线程、多进程等技术,提高计算效率。
- 内存优化:优化内存访问模式,降低内存占用和延迟。
- 算法优化:针对特定应用场景,优化算法以提高性能。
大模型推理挑战
1. 能耗问题
大模型推理过程中,硬件和软件的能耗较高,这对环境造成了较大压力。因此,降低能耗是当前大模型推理领域的重要研究方向。
2. 安全性问题
大模型推理过程中,可能存在数据泄露、模型窃取等安全问题。因此,加强大模型推理的安全性研究至关重要。
3. 模型可解释性
大模型推理结果往往缺乏可解释性,这对于一些需要透明度的应用场景来说是一个挑战。
未来发展趋势
1. 软硬件协同优化
未来,大模型推理将朝着软硬件协同优化的方向发展,通过硬件加速、软件优化等技术,进一步提高大模型推理的性能。
2. 模型轻量化
随着移动设备和物联网设备的普及,模型轻量化将成为大模型推理领域的重要研究方向。通过模型压缩、量化等技术,降低模型复杂度和计算量。
3. 安全性与隐私保护
未来,大模型推理将更加注重安全性与隐私保护,确保用户数据的安全和隐私。
结论
大模型推理作为AI技术的重要环节,其高效能和背后的秘密引发了广泛关注。通过模型压缩与加速、硬件加速、软件优化等关键技术,大模型推理性能不断提升。然而,能耗、安全性和模型可解释性等问题仍需进一步研究。未来,大模型推理将朝着软硬件协同优化、模型轻量化、安全性与隐私保护等方向发展。